Thapa calls for investment-friendly environment



HETAUDA: Chairperson of Rastriya Prajatantra Party (RPP) Kamal Thapa has emphasized the need for creating investment-friendly environment to attract foreign investors in the country.

Speaking at a program in Hetauda on Sunday, Thapa said the country must assure the investors that no corruptions and irregularities will take place.
